What is the IELTS Certificate?

The IELTS certificate is a standardized test that examines a candidate's skills in listening, reading, composing, and speaking. It is collectively managed by the British Council, IDP: IELTS Australia, and Cambridge Assessment English. The test is readily available in 2 formats: Academic and General Training. The Academic format is appropriate for those getting greater education or professional registration, while the General Training format is designed for those who are migrating to an English-speaking nation or getting secondary education, training programs, or work experience.

Structure of the IELTS Test

The IELTS test is divided into 4 areas, each created to evaluate a particular language skill:

  1. Listening (30 minutes)

    • The listening section includes 4 taped texts, varying from a discussion in between two people to a monologue on an academic subject.
    • Prospects respond to a series of questions based upon what they hear, including multiple-choice, matching, and short-answer questions.
  2. Reading (60 minutes)

    • The reading area includes three long texts, which may be descriptive, factual, or discursive.
    • Texts are drawn from books, newspapers, magazines, and other sources, and prospects are required to respond to 40 concerns, which may include multiple-choice, recognizing information, and summing up.
  3. Composing (60 minutes)

    • The writing section includes 2 tasks:
      • Task 1 (20 minutes): For the Academic format, candidates should explain a graph, chart, table, or diagram. For the General Training format, prospects must compose a letter.
      • Task 2 (40 minutes): Candidates need to write an essay in action to a point of view, argument, or issue.
  4. Speaking (11-14 minutes)

    • The speaking area is a face-to-face interview with a qualified inspector.
    • It is divided into 3 parts:
      • Part 1 (4-5 minutes): General questions about the prospect's life, interests, and experiences.
      • Part 2 (3-4 minutes): The candidate is given a topic and has one minute to prepare before promoting one to 2 minutes.
      • Part 3 (4-5 minutes): A conversation on the subject from Part 2, where the inspector asks more abstract and intricate questions.

Scoring and Results

The IELTS test is scored on a scale from 0 to 9, with 9 being the greatest. Each section (listening, reading, writing, and speaking) is scored separately, and the total band score is the average of these 4 scores. The scores are reported in half bands, except for the overall band score, which is reported to the closest whole or half band.

  • Band 9: Expert user
  • Band 8: Very good user
  • Band 7: Good user
  • Band 6: Competent user
  • Band 5: Modest user
  • Band 4: Limited user
  • Band 3: Extremely minimal user
  • Band 2: Intermittent user
  • Band 1: Non-user
  • Band 0: Did not attempt the test

Prospects usually get their outcomes within 13 days of taking the test. The results are legitimate for 2 years, although some organizations may accept older ratings if the candidate can offer proof that their language skills have actually not decreased.

FAQs About the IELTS Certificate

Q1: How do I sign up for the IELTS test?

  • You can sign up for the IELTS test online through the main IELTS website or at a regional test center. The process involves picking a test date, paying the registration charge, and supplying individual information.

Q2: How much does the IELTS test expense?

  • The expense of the IELTS test varies by nation and test center. Usually, the cost ranges from ₤ 200 to ₤ 250 GBP. It is important to inspect the specific cost in your region.

Q3: Can I retake the IELTS test if I am not pleased with my score?

  • Yes, you can retake the IELTS test as numerous times as you require. Nevertheless, it is recommended to wait for a reasonable duration and utilize the time to enhance your abilities and prepare better.

Q4: What is the difference in between the Academic and General Training formats?

  • The Academic format is tailored towards candidates who wish to study at a university or professional organization, while the General Training format is developed for those who are migrating to an English-speaking nation or seeking non-academic training or work experience.

Q5: How long are IELTS ratings valid?

  • IELTS scores stand for two years. However, some institutions might accept scores that are older, provided the prospect can demonstrate that their language abilities have not declined.

Q6: Can I cancel my test?

  • Yes, you can cancel your test, but you should do so a minimum of five weeks before the test date to get a refund. Cancellations made after this period are not qualified for a refund.

Q7: What if I need special accommodations due to a special needs?

  • IELTS offers unique accommodations for prospects with disabilities, including prolonged time, large print materials, and extra assistance. You need to contact your test center to discuss your particular needs.

Q8: What happens if I miss my test?

  • If you miss your test without prior notice, you will not be qualified for a refund. In cases of genuine emergency situations, you ought to call the test center as soon as possible to describe the situation.
